ورود / عضویت 021-91015555
منو

ماشین مجازی

ماشین مجازی
تاریخ انتشار:29-04-1402

ماشین مجازی (Virtual Machine) چیست؟ | کاربرد ماشین‌های مجازی چه می‌باشد

در این مطلب قصد داریم به این موضوع بپردازیم که ماشین مجازی چیست و چه کاربرد‌هایی برای کسب و کار شما دارد.

Virtual Machineیک کامپیوتر مبتنی بر نرم‌افزار است که در سیستم عامل رایانه دیگری وجود دارد و اغلب برای اهداف آزمایش، پشتیبان‌گیری از داده‌ها یا اجرای برنامه‌های SaaS استفاده می‌شود.

به عبارت ساده می‌توان گفت که ماشین مجازی یک نسخه دیجیتالی از یک رایانه فیزیکی است.

ماشین مجازی (VM) یک محیط مجازی است که به عنوان یک سیستم کامپیوتر مجازی با CPU، RAM، DISK و رابط شبکه عمل می‌کند که بر روی یک سرور فیزیکی ایجاد شده است.

چندین ماشین مجازی را می‌توان روی یک ماشین فیزیکی مانند سرور میزبانی کرد و با استفاده از نرم‌افزار آنها را مدیریت کرد و بر اساس نوع نیاز خود می‌توان روی آنها سیستم عامل‌های متفاوت نصب و از آنها استفاده کرد.

این امکان انعطاف‌پذیری را برای منابع رایانشی (پردازنده، ذخیره‌سازی، شبکه) فراهم می‌کند تا در صورت نیاز بین ماشین‌‌ها توزیع و بازدهی کلی را افزایش دهد.

این معماری اجزای تشکیل‌دهنده‌ای را برای منابع مجازی‌سازی پیشرفته‌ای را که امروزه استفاده می‌کنیم از جمله رایانش ابری همچون سرور ابری، فراهم می‌کند.

بیشتر بدانید : سرور مجازی چیست و چه کاربردی دارد؟

تعریف ماشین مجازی

ماشین مجازی یک نمونه مجازی‌سازی‌شده از یک رایانه است که تقریباً همه عملکردهای مشابه یک رایانه دارد و می‌تواند انواع اپلیکیشن‌ها و سیستم‌های عامل مختلف را اجرا کند.

این ماشین‌ها روی یک ماشین فیزیکی اجرا می‌شوند و به منابع رایانشی از طریق نرم‌افزاری به‌نام هایپروایزر (Hypervisor) دسترسی دارند و می‌توان همچون یک سرور مجازی ابری از آن استفاده کرد.

هایپروایزر، منابع ماشین فیزیکی را تفکیک می‌کند و در صورت نیاز می‌تواند منجر به واگذاری و توزیع شوند که در نهایت چندین ماشین مجازی را قادر می‌کند تا روی یک ماشین فیزیکی واحد اجرا و کار کنند.

کاربردهای ماشین مجازی

کاربردهای ماشین مجازی

کاربرد ماشین مجازی چیست ؟

حال وقت این رسیده است که با این موضوع آشنا شویم که کاربرد سرور مجازی چیست و چگونه می‌توانند در رشد و توسعه کسب کار ما دخالت داشته باشند.

مجازی‌سازی این امکان را فراهم می‌آورد که چندین ماشین مجازی، که هرکدام دارای سیستم عامل (OS) و برنامه‌های کاربردی خاص خود هستند، بر روی یک ماشین فیزیکی واحد ایجاد کنند.

ماشین‌های مجازی اجزای تشکیل‌دهنده پایه برای منابع رایانشی مجازی‌سازی شده هستند

و نقش اصلی را در ایجاد هر اپلیکیشن، ابزار یا محیطی برای ماشین‌های مجازی آنلاین و درون سازمانی را ایفا می‌کنند.

چند مورد از متداول‌ترین کاربردهای ماشین‌های مجازی به شرح زیر می‌باشند:

یکپارچه‌سازی سرورها

ماشین‌های مجازی را می‌توان به‌عنوان سرورهایی راه‌اندازی کرد که میزبان ماشین‌های دیگر هستند،

که به سازمان‌ها اجازه می‌دهد تا با تمرکز منابع روی یک ماشین فیزیکی، پراکندگی آن‌ها را کاهش دهند.

ایجاد محیط‌های توسعه و تست

ماشین‌های مجازی می‌توانند به‌عنوان محیط‌های ایزوله برای تست و توسعه نرم‌افزار عمل کنند که دارای عملکرد کامل هستند اما هیچ تأثیری بر زیرساخت اطراف خود ندارند.

در این حالت بدون نگرانی و هیچ مشکلی می‌توان نسبت به توسعه نرم افزار خود بپردازید.

پشتیبانی از دواپس

ماشین‌های مجازی را می‌توان به راحتی خاموش یا روشن، انتقال و تطبیق داد و حداکثر انعطاف‌پذیری را برای توسعه فراهم می‌کنند.

بیشتر بدانید : تفاوت سرور ابری و سرور مجازی چیست ؟

مهاجرت بارکاری

انعطاف‌پذیری و قابل حمل بودن ماشین‌های مجازی، یک راهکار کلیدی برای افزایش سرعت مهاجرت است.

بهبود بازیابی از فاجعه و تداوم کسب‌وکار

یکی دیگر از مهم‌ترین کاربردهای ماشین مجازی بازیابی از فاجعه می‌باشد.

تکثیر سامانه‌ها در محیط‌های ابری با استفاده از ماشین‌های مجازی می‌تواند یک لایه اضافی از امنیت و اطمینان را فراهم کند.

محیط‌های ابری نیز می‌توانند به طور مستمر به‌روز رسانی شوند.

ایجاد یک محیط ترکیبی

ماشین‌های مجازی، اساس بنیادین را برای ایجاد یک محیط ابری در کنار محیط‌های داخل سازمانی بدون رهاسازی سامانه‌های قدیمی فراهم می‌کنند که در نهایت منجر به انعطاف‌پذیری بیشتر می‌شوند.

خدمات ابری زیرساخت (laaS)
فقط با چند کلیک سرور ابری خود را بسازید!
شروع کنید